What Is Arienne—and Why Does It Matter for Early Childhood Development?
Arienne is a tablet- and web-based early learning platform launched in 2021 by EduNova Labs, a Boston-based edtech nonprofit founded by developmental psychologists and former Head Start curriculum directors. Designed specifically for children aged 3 to 6 years, Arienne delivers structured, play-based instruction in foundational literacy (phonemic awareness, letter-sound correspondence, emergent writing) and numeracy (counting, subitizing, pattern recognition, simple addition). Unlike generic educational apps, Arienne embeds dynamic scaffolding—real-time adjustment of task difficulty based on response latency, error patterns, and gesture fluency—validated through a 2023 randomized controlled trial published in Early Childhood Research Quarterly. In that study, 412 preschoolers using Arienne 15 minutes daily over 12 weeks showed statistically significant gains: +37% improvement in rhyming detection (vs. +12% in control group using ABCmouse), and +29% increase in one-to-one counting accuracy (vs. +8% with Khan Academy Kids). These outcomes reflect intentional design rooted in Vygotsky’s zone of proximal development and Piaget’s sensorimotor and preoperational stage principles.
The platform operates on a dual-access model: children engage independently with animated story sequences and interactive manipulatives, while caregivers receive weekly progress dashboards via the Arienne Family Portal. Each child’s profile logs not just correct/incorrect responses but also dwell time on visual cues, swipe direction consistency, and vocalization attempts captured via optional microphone input (processed locally on-device; no audio stored or transmitted). This granular behavioral data informs both adaptive algorithms and teacher-facing reports—making Arienne less a ‘screen time’ tool and more a diagnostic and instructional extension of classroom practice.
Developmental Foundations: How Arienne Aligns With Cognitive Milestones
Phonological Awareness Through Embodied Interaction
Arienne’s literacy module begins at age 3 with syllable clapping games using animated animal characters—e.g., tapping a frog’s belly three times for ‘but-ter-fly’. This leverages multisensory integration, a core strategy supported by the National Institute for Literacy’s 2022 meta-analysis showing 2.3× greater retention when motor action accompanies auditory input. At age 4, children progress to phoneme isolation tasks where they drag sound icons (e.g., a buzzing bee for /b/) into segmented word boxes. The interface enforces sequential engagement: before advancing to ‘cat’, learners must first complete five trials with monosyllabic CVC words (‘dog’, ‘sun’, ‘pen’) with ≥85% accuracy and average response latency under 3.2 seconds.
Crucially, Arienne avoids phonics-first instruction—a common misstep in early apps. Instead, it follows the sequence recommended by the International Dyslexia Association: phonological awareness → alphabet knowledge → phonics. By age 5, children encounter decodable mini-books with controlled vocabulary (e.g., ‘The Red Hen’ uses only short-vowel CVC words and high-frequency sight words from Dolch’s Pre-K list). Each book includes embedded comprehension checks: ‘Tap the picture that shows what happened first’ or ‘Which word rhymes with ‘bed’?’. Response analytics track whether children rely on initial letter cues (a red flag for weak phonemic decoding) versus full-word matching—a distinction that informs differentiated small-group instruction.
Numeracy Scaffolding Based on Subitizing Thresholds
For mathematics, Arienne adheres strictly to research on perceptual subitizing—the ability to instantly recognize quantities up to 4 without counting. Its number sense pathway starts at age 3 with dot-pattern matching (e.g., ‘Find the card with the same number of ladybugs as this one’) using canonical arrangements (dice, dominoes, ten-frame layouts). At age 4, it introduces conceptual subitizing—grouping sets into chunks (e.g., ‘5’ shown as 2 + 3). Tasks require dragging numbered tiles to match grouped visuals, with immediate feedback if grouping violates part-whole relationships (e.g., placing ‘4’ over a 2+2 arrangement but rejecting ‘3’ over 2+1).
By age 5, Arienne introduces additive reasoning via concrete contexts: ‘Lila has 3 apples. Her brother gives her 2 more. Drag the apples to the basket.’ Children manipulate virtual fruit, reinforcing cardinality and commutativity. The system detects whether learners recount from 1 (indicating weak number conservation) or use ‘counting on’ (starting from 3 and saying ‘4, 5’)—a key developmental marker assessed in the 2020 Early Math Assessment (EMA). Pilot data from Chicago Public Schools’ Early Learning Centers showed that 68% of Arienne users mastered counting-on strategies by week 8, compared to 41% in classrooms using only physical manipulatives.
Hardware and Accessibility Design: Meeting Real-World Classroom Constraints
Arienne was stress-tested across 17 device models used in Title I preschools, including low-cost Android tablets (Amazon Fire HD 8 2022, $79.99 retail), iPads (iPad 9th gen, $329), and Chromebooks (Acer Chromebook Spin 311, $249). Performance benchmarks required <1.2 seconds average load time for core activities on devices with ≤2GB RAM and offline functionality for at least 45 minutes of uninterrupted use—critical for schools with spotty broadband. All animations render at 60fps even on Fire tablets, achieved by limiting vector-based assets and compressing audio to Opus format at 48 kbps.
Accessibility was built from inception—not retrofitted. Arienne supports switch scanning (with Tobii Dynavox and AbleNet devices), voice commands via Web Speech API (tested with Google Assistant and Apple Voice Control), and screen reader compatibility (JAWS, NVDA, VoiceOver). Color contrast meets WCAG 2.1 AA standards (minimum 4.5:1 ratio), and all text scales fluidly from 12pt to 24pt without layout breakage. Notably, Arienne disables auto-play video and requires explicit tap-to-start for all audio—reducing sensory overload for children with autism spectrum disorder. A 2023 usability study at the Kennedy Krieger Institute found 92% of preschoolers with moderate language delays successfully navigated Arienne’s home screen using only two-tap gestures, compared to 63% success rate with Khan Academy Kids’ navigation bar.
Evidence Base: What Rigorous Studies Reveal About Efficacy
Arienne’s efficacy rests on three peer-reviewed studies conducted between 2022 and 2024. The largest, a cluster RCT funded by the U.S. Department of Education’s IES grant (R305A210257), enrolled 1,028 children across 12 preschools in Ohio, Texas, and Washington State. Schools were stratified by poverty level (measured by % free/reduced lunch eligibility) and randomly assigned to Arienne + standard curriculum (n=614) or business-as-usual (n=414). Primary outcomes were measured using the DIBELS 8th Edition Phonemic Segmentation Fluency (PSF) and the Test of Early Mathematics Ability–Third Edition (TEMA-3).
Results showed effect sizes of d = 0.41 for PSF (p < 0.001) and d = 0.36 for TEMA-3 (p = 0.002) after 16 weeks—equivalent to 2.7 months of additional growth in literacy and 2.3 months in math relative to controls. Gains were strongest among dual-language learners (DLLs): Spanish-speaking children in the Arienne group gained +44% in English phoneme blending vs. +19% in controls, likely due to Arienne’s consistent phoneme articulation modeling (recorded by speech-language pathologists using clear, slow articulation without exaggerated mouth movements).
- Mean weekly usage: 14.2 minutes (SD = 3.7), tracked via encrypted device logs
- Teacher fidelity of implementation: 91% adherence to recommended 3x/week schedule (verified by classroom observation checklists)
- Dropout rate: 2.3% (vs. industry average of 18% for preschool apps per Common Sense Media’s 2023 EdTech Retention Report)
A secondary analysis examined dosage-response relationships. Children logging ≥12 minutes/week showed linear gains: each additional minute correlated with +0.8 points on PSF (r = 0.63, p < 0.001) and +0.6 points on TEMA-3 (r = 0.57, p = 0.002). No ceiling effect was observed—even children averaging 22 minutes/week continued gaining, suggesting Arienne’s adaptive engine maintains appropriate challenge levels across wide ability ranges.
Curriculum Integration: How Teachers Use Arienne in Daily Practice
Blended Learning Rotations That Respect Attention Spans
Classroom implementation follows a 15-minute station rotation model aligned with NAEYC’s position statement on technology use. Teachers assign Arienne as one of four stations: (1) small-group teacher-led instruction, (2) hands-on manipulative center, (3) outdoor gross-motor activity, and (4) Arienne tablet station. Each station lasts 12–15 minutes, respecting preschoolers’ documented attention span of 12–15 minutes for focused tasks (per the American Academy of Pediatrics’ 2022 clinical report).
Teachers use Arienne’s ‘Lesson Sync’ feature to mirror in-app activities with physical materials. For example, after a child completes Arienne’s ‘Pattern Block Puzzles’ (identifying ABAB and AABA sequences), the teacher provides real foam pattern blocks and asks, ‘Can you make the same pattern with these?’ This cross-modal reinforcement strengthens neural pathways—supported by fMRI studies showing 40% greater hippocampal activation when digital and physical tasks are temporally linked.
Caregiver Engagement Beyond the Dashboard
The Arienne Family Portal goes beyond progress reports. Each Friday, caregivers receive a personalized ‘Home Connection Kit’: a printable PDF with 1–2 low-tech extensions (e.g., ‘Sound Hunt: Find 3 things in your kitchen that start with /m/’) and a 60-second video of their child’s recent achievement (e.g., correctly segmenting ‘ship’ into /sh/ /i/ /p/). Videos are generated automatically, never stored, and deleted after 72 hours. In a survey of 327 families, 78% reported doing at least one Home Connection activity weekly—significantly higher than the 31% engagement rate with generic app newsletters.
Language support is robust: family communications auto-translate into 12 languages (Spanish, Mandarin, Arabic, Vietnamese, Somali, Haitian Creole, Portuguese, Russian, Korean, Tagalog, French, and Urdu) using Google Cloud Translation API v3, with human-reviewed glossaries for early childhood terms (e.g., ‘subitizing’ renders as ‘seeing how many without counting’ in Spanish). This addresses a critical gap—only 22% of early learning apps offer multilingual family communication, per the Joan Ganz Cooney Center’s 2023 Digital Equity Index.
Data Privacy, Security, and Ethical Safeguards
Arienne complies with COPPA, FERPA, and GDPR-K, undergoing annual third-party audits by TRUSTe (now TrustArc). All child data is encrypted in transit (TLS 1.3) and at rest (AES-256). Crucially, Arienne does not collect biometric data (no facial recognition, no keystroke dynamics) and anonymizes behavioral logs within 24 hours of collection—retaining only aggregated, de-identified metrics for algorithm refinement. Device identifiers are hashed and rotated weekly.
Unlike commercial platforms, Arienne prohibits advertising, data licensing, or behavioral profiling. Its revenue model is subscription-based for institutions ($2.95/child/year) and freemium for families (core literacy/numeracy free; premium features like multilingual storybooks and progress exports cost $4.99/month). EduNova Labs publishes annual transparency reports detailing data requests received (zero government or third-party requests in 2023) and security incidents (none reported since launch).
Teachers receive mandatory privacy training during onboarding, covering topics like secure device storage (requiring passcode locks on all tablets) and classroom protocols for shared devices (e.g., ‘Always log out before handing to next child’). These practices reduced accidental data exposure incidents by 94% in Year 1 implementation schools, per internal incident tracking.
